Butland looking for loan move

Stoke City’s Jack Butland is keen to go out on loan as he hopes to boost his chances of being part of England’s World Cup party, the Mirror understands.

Victory in Ukraine tomorrow (Tuesday) evening will put Roy Hodgson’s men in pole position to qualify for next summer’s tournament in Brazil, and Butland wants to be involved if they make it.

He is yet to make an appearance for Stoke City since signing from Birmingham City in January, though he spent the second half of last season back on loan at St Andrews.

Even more worryingly for the 20 year old, is that he has only made the substitute bench in one of the Potters four matches this season, with Thomas Sorenson and number one Asmir Begovic ahead of him in the pecking order.

Sporting Lisbon and Sheffield Wednesday are both interested in securing his services for the remainder of the campaign, and manager Mark Hughes is considering which would be of more benefit to the U21 international in the long term.
